37717-022: Supplementary Support for Poverty Reduction Intitatives in Pakistan
Project Data Sheet (PDS): Overview
Description
Through this TA PRM plans to have an place a Poverty Reduction specialist who will assist in mainstreaming and expanding ADB`s analytical work in Pakistan. While the above objective remains valid and work is proceeding as envisaged. It was felt that it wooul be very important for ADB through the SSTA to support the Pakistan Development Forum (PDF) that was held in Islamabad from 17 -19 March 2004... Read More
